Xiaodong Wu has authored 35 papers that have received a total of 655 indexed citations.
This includes 23 papers in Pathology and Forensic Medicine, 21 papers in Surgery and 9 papers in Materials Chemistry. The topics of these papers are Spine and Intervertebral Disc Pathology (23 papers), Cervical and Thoracic Myelopathy (13 papers) and Spinal Fractures and Fixation Techniques (12 papers). Xiaodong Wu is often cited by papers focused on Spine and Intervertebral Disc Pathology (23 papers), Cervical and Thoracic Myelopathy (13 papers) and Spinal Fractures and Fixation Techniques (12 papers) and collaborates with scholars based in China, Australia and Hong Kong. Xiaodong Wu's co-authors include Shu Cai, Guohua Xu, Jianxi Wang, Huajiang Chen and Wen Yuan and has published in prestigious journals such as Spine, Journal of Controlled Release and Applied Surface Science.
